New Delhi: Price Waterhouse (PW) on Thursday said there has been no intentional wrongdoing by its firms in the Satyam case and expressed confidence of getting a stay on the SEBI order. The audit major also said it has learnt the lessons from Satyam case and invested heavily over the past nine years in building a robust audit practice. Finding PW guilty in the Satyam scam, SEBI has barred its entities from issuing audit certificates to any listed company in India for two years. Besides, SEBI has ordered disgorgement of over Rs 13 crore wrongful gains by the audit major and its two erstwhile partners. PTI
